How does the Yes or No Generator work?
Press the button and the tool randomly selects one of two answers: Yes or No. You can generate another answer immediately.
The tool makes one independent random selection between Yes and No. There is no Maybe result, weighting, question history, or connection to previous answers.
It is framed as a direct two-answer decision tool rather than a coin simulation. If you specifically want Heads or Tails, use Coin Flip.
Results are generated locally and are not saved. Do not use a random answer for medical, legal, financial, safety, or other high-stakes decisions.
